默認情況下,this指向全局對象
var x=1;
function test(){
console.log(this.x)
}
test()//1
此時等價于
var x=1;
function test(){
console.log(window.x)
}
test()
也就是說this==window
var x=1;
function test(){
this.x=0
console.log(this.x)
}
test()//0
默認情況下,this指向全局對象
var x=1;
function test(){
console.log(this.x)
}
test()//1
此時等價于
var x=1;
function test(){
console.log(window.x)
}
test()
也就是說this==window
var x=1;
function test(){
this.x=0
console.log(this.x)
}
test()//0